AAGEF Ontario includes alumni from the following Elite French Graduate Schools: Audencia Business School,Arts et Métiers Paris Tech, Ecoles Centrales, EDHEC Business School, EM Lyon, Grenoble Ecole de Management, ENA, ENS Normale Sup, ESSEC Business School, ESCP Business School, INSEAD Business School, Kedge Business School, Mines-Télécom, Neoma Business School, HEC Paris, Ecole Polytechnique Paris, ENPC Paris Tech, Sciences Po , Supaéro, Supélec , TBS Business School, Agro , ENSTA Paris Tech, Chimie Paris Tech, ENSAE Paris Tech, Sup Optique Paris Tech, ESPCI Paris Tech, Dauphine, INSA, TBS, Sorbonne, IAE, UTC...
AAGEF Ontario also includes alumni having participated in an exchange with one of AAGEF Ontario graduate schools, Honorary Members and Alumni Friends from other leading international universities.
Our Mission
To improve the recognition of the Elite French Graduate Schools among the Ontario Business Community
To facilitate and promote networking between our members and alumni from leading Ontario and Canadian Graduate Schools ( Engineering, Management, Public Administration ) as well as with alumni from any other leading universities around the world or members of prestigious business clubs in Toronto. In short , we are linking international business leaders in Ontario together
